How to Make the Recipe

Step 1: Preheat and Prepare

Preheat your oven to 350°F (175°C). Line a muffin tin with paper liners or grease the tin.

Step 2: Mix Dry Ingredients

In a large bowl, whisk together flour, sugar, baking soda, and salt.

Step 3: Cream Butter and Wet Ingredients

In another bowl, cream the butter until smooth. Add Greek yogurt, milk, egg, and vanilla extract, mixing until combined.

Step 4: Combine Wet and Dry

Pour the wet ingredients into the dry ingredients and gently fold until just combined. Avoid overmixing to keep muffins tender.

Step 5: Add Chocolate Chips

Fold in the chocolate chips evenly throughout the batter.

Step 6: Bake

Spoon the batter into the prepared muffin tin, filling each cup about two-thirds full. Bake for 18–22 minutes or until a toothpick inserted in the center comes out clean.

Step 7: Cool and Serve

Allow muffins to cool in the tin for a few minutes before transferring to a wire rack to cool completely. Serve warm or at room temperature.

Tips for Making the Recipe

  • Use room-temperature butter for easier mixing.
  • Don’t overmix the batter to avoid dense muffins.
  • Measure flour properly to prevent dry muffins.
  • Add mix-ins gently and evenly for consistent flavor.
  • Use fresh baking soda for best rise and texture.

Make Ahead and Storage

Storing Leftovers

Store muffins in an airtight container at room temperature for up to 3 days.

Freezing

Freeze cooled muffins in a sealed freezer bag for up to 2 months. Thaw at room temperature or warm in the oven.

Reheating

Reheat muffins in the microwave for 15–20 seconds or in a 350°F oven for 5–7 minutes for a freshly baked texture.

Muffins with Greek Yogurt


5 Stars 4 Stars 3 Stars 2 Stars 1 Star

No reviews

  • Author: Elizabeth
  • Total Time: 30 minutes
  • Yield: 12 muffins 1x
  • Diet: Vegetarian

Description

Moist, tender muffins made healthier and fluffier with creamy Greek yogurt. These easy-to-make chocolate chip muffins are perfect for breakfast, snacks, or dessert, offering a delicious balance of sweetness and rich texture.


Ingredients

Scale
  • 2 cups all-purpose flour

  • ¾ cup sugar

  • 1 teaspoon baking soda

  • ½ teaspoon salt

  • ½ cup unsalted butter, softened

  • 1 cup plain Greek yogurt

  • ½ cup milk (2% or whole)

  • 1 large egg

  • 1 teaspoon vanilla extract

  • ¾ cup chocolate chips


Instructions

  • Preheat oven to 375°F (190°C). Line a muffin tin with paper liners or grease it lightly.

  • In a large bowl, whisk together flour, sugar, baking soda, and salt.

  • In another bowl, beat butter until creamy. Add Greek yogurt, milk, egg, and vanilla extract; mix until smooth and well combined.

  • Pour wet ingredients into dry ingredients and gently fold until just combined. Avoid overmixing.

  • Fold in chocolate chips.

  • Divide the batter evenly among the muffin cups, filling each about ¾ full.

  • Bake for 18–22 minutes or until a toothpick inserted in the center comes out clean.

  • Let muffins cool in the pan for 5 minutes, then transfer to a wire rack to cool completely.

Notes

  • For extra moistness, substitute half the milk with buttermilk.

  • You can swap chocolate chips for blueberries or nuts if desired.

  • Store muffins in an airtight container at room temperature for up to 3 days.
